The authors describe first results of the observational programme of photometry and spectroscopy of the ESO Nearby Abell Cluster Survey (ENACS). The final data base contains a total of 5634 galaxies in the direction of 107 clusters with richness class R ≥ 1 and redshift z ≤ 0.1. Applying a velocity gap of 1000 km/s, the authors identify galaxy systems in the 107 "pencil-beam" surveys. The large majority of the clusters observed appear to be real, physical systems.
